Man sought in connection to 2020 murder investigation

Oct 7, 2021 | 5:37 PM

The Prince Albert Police Service is asking for the public’s assistance locating a man, charged with second degree murder and aggravated assault.

Kyle Thurston Bear, 30, is wanted in connection with the death of Tyson Lafonde. The violent incident happened in January of 2020.

A warrant has been issued for Bear’s arrest. Police say he is considered dangerous and should not be approached.

Anyone with information on where he may be is asked to contact police immediately at 306-953-4222 or Crime Stoppers at 1-800-222-8477.
